SQL - Security BasicsHow can combining SQL roles with permission grants improve database security?ABy automatically backing up data dailyBBy allowing all users to have full accessCBy grouping users and managing permissions efficientlyDBy disabling password requirements for rolesCheck Answer
Step-by-Step SolutionSolution:Step 1: Understand the purpose of SQL rolesRoles group users to simplify permission management.Step 2: See how roles improve securityAssigning permissions to roles reduces errors and ensures consistent access control.Final Answer:By grouping users and managing permissions efficiently -> Option CQuick Check:Roles = Efficient permission management [OK]Quick Trick: Use roles to simplify permission control [OK]Common Mistakes:Thinking roles give full access by defaultBelieving roles disable passwordsConfusing roles with backups
Master "Security Basics" in SQL9 interactive learning modes - each teaches the same concept differentlyLearnWhyDeepVisualTryChallengeProjectRecallTime
More SQL Quizzes Advanced Query Patterns - Top-N per group query - Quiz 7medium CASE Expressions - COALESCE and NULLIF as CASE shortcuts - Quiz 3easy Common Table Expressions (CTEs) - Recursive CTE for hierarchical data - Quiz 8hard Database Design and Normalization - Star schema concept - Quiz 5medium SQL Security Basics - Why prepared statements exist - Quiz 1easy Stored Procedures and Functions - Parameters (IN, OUT, INOUT) - Quiz 4medium Triggers - Trigger performance considerations - Quiz 6medium Triggers - Why triggers are needed - Quiz 14medium Triggers - INSERT trigger - Quiz 12easy Window Functions Fundamentals - Window function vs GROUP BY mental model - Quiz 9hard